  • Publication number: 20230073028
    Abstract: A flexible coaxial tissue sampling device, comprising: a sheath; a displaceable wire within the sheath having a first end extending from a proximal end of the sheath and second end which extends, in a first state, from a distal end of the sheath, and in a second state, retracts into the distal end of the sheath; the second end of the displaceable wire comprising a cellular sampling structure and a porous absorptive material which are external to the sheath in the first state and internal in the second state. A tension on the first end of the displaceable wire at the proximal end of the sheath retracts the displaceable wire from the first state to the second state, along with the cellular sampling structure and the porous absorptive material. The porous absorptive material retains a fluid sample after retraction and protects against contact of the sample with other tissues.

  • Publication number: 20230022536
    Abstract: A biopsy device, comprising a flexible coaxial structure, comprising a wire within a sheath, the wire being adapted to be displaced with respect to the sheath along the coaxial axis by a force applied at a proximal end; a disruptor, at a distal end of the obturator, adapted to disrupt a tissue surface to free cells therefrom, having a first position covered within the sheath and a second position freely extending beyond the sheath; an element, on an exterior of the sheath, configured to limit a depth of insertion of the sheath into a body orifice.
